在线看毛片网站电影-亚洲国产欧美日韩精品一区二区三区,国产欧美乱夫不卡无乱码,国产精品欧美久久久天天影视,精品一区二区三区视频在线观看,亚洲国产精品人成乱码天天看,日韩久久久一区,91精品国产91免费

<menu id="6qfwx"><li id="6qfwx"></li></menu>
    1. <menu id="6qfwx"><dl id="6qfwx"></dl></menu>

      <label id="6qfwx"><ol id="6qfwx"></ol></label><menu id="6qfwx"></menu><object id="6qfwx"><strike id="6qfwx"><noscript id="6qfwx"></noscript></strike></object>
        1. <center id="6qfwx"><dl id="6qfwx"></dl></center>

            新聞中心

            EEPW首頁(yè) > 嵌入式系統(tǒng) > 設(shè)計(jì)應(yīng)用 > STC單片機(jī)開(kāi)發(fā)注意事項(xiàng)

            STC單片機(jī)開(kāi)發(fā)注意事項(xiàng)

            作者: 時(shí)間:2013-05-11 來(lái)源:網(wǎng)絡(luò) 收藏

            ISP燒寫(xiě)程序

            程序無(wú)法下載進(jìn)MCU,可能出錯(cuò)的地方有:如果準(zhǔn)備條件充分

            (驅(qū)動(dòng)程序安裝成功、STC_ISP.EXE安裝成功),在下載程序進(jìn)入MCU的時(shí)候,需要對(duì)ISP軟件進(jìn)行參數(shù)的設(shè)置。

            Ⅰ:MCU Type選項(xiàng),我用的是STC89C54RD+。(型號(hào)必須匹配)

            Ⅱ:(CH3415SER.EXE)驅(qū)動(dòng)安裝成功后,中查看端口(COM和LPT),

            其中的USB-SERIAL CH340(COM4)中的COM4是可以和MCU連接的通信端口。其他通訊端口(COM1和COM2)

            在沒(méi)有必要的情況下不要使用。選擇COM4,Max Buad參數(shù)選默認(rèn)。

            Ⅲ:根據(jù)MCU支持的晶振頻率選擇OSCDN(OSC Control):選擇oscillator的頻率,

            具體選項(xiàng)根據(jù)oscillator的情況而定。

            Ⅳ:注意冷啟動(dòng)的步驟,斷電后進(jìn)行下載,再按按鈕或者接通電源給MCU上電復(fù)位。

            HEX文件生成

            Ⅰ:正確安裝 Keil uVision2 或 Keil uVision3,推薦安裝Keil uVision2。

            Ⅱ:創(chuàng)建工程(New Project),輸入工程名 Test1.uv2 ,這里擴(kuò)展名可省略。

            單擊保存彈出MCU型號(hào)選擇對(duì)話框,我用的是STC89C54RD+,但是找不到STC系列的(國(guó)產(chǎn))。

            找到匹配類型CPU后,選中并單擊確定。彈出

            “Copy Standard 8051 Startup Code to Project Folder and Add File to Project?”

            但是不要添加,選否。這樣一個(gè)空Keil工程就OK了。

            Ⅲ:右單擊源文件組的Source Group1后點(diǎn)擊 Add files to Group ’Source Group 1’,查找編號(hào)的C文件,

            雙擊選中后選擇Close,就把文件添加進(jìn)去了。

            Ⅳ:進(jìn)行編譯,有錯(cuò)的話改正,形成正確的C文件。

            Ⅴ:右單擊源文件種的Target 1,選Options for Targets ’Target 1’,

            彈出對(duì)話框,在output中選中Creat HEX file,

            確定。重新編譯,會(huì)生成 Test1.hex 文件。ISP中就是將此文件燒寫(xiě)進(jìn)MCU。

            其它

            Ⅰ:由于STC屬于國(guó)產(chǎn)芯片,在Keil沒(méi)有針對(duì)這種芯片的資源,

            所以在編譯C或匯編程序的時(shí)候可以找到Atmel、Intel、SST的,卻找不到STC系列的。

            此時(shí)可以選擇AT89S52系列替代STC89C54RD+系列(相同51內(nèi)核),原來(lái)試過(guò)AT89C系列的,

            生成的 .hex文件在燒入MCU后不生效。

            Ⅱ:AT89C系列不支持ISP技術(shù),

            在使用ISP的MCU中不能選C系列的芯片資源生成.hex,否則無(wú)法和MCU進(jìn)行通訊。

            Ⅲ:每次重新連接MCU的usb端口時(shí),

            分配的COM端口和上次的可能會(huì)不一樣,所以在ISP中,事先查看的端口(COM和LPT)上的顯示。

            usb轉(zhuǎn)串口線 stc官方是推薦的ch340芯片的.



            評(píng)論


            相關(guān)推薦

            技術(shù)專區(qū)

            關(guān)閉